Jagodno

Forum osiedla Cztery Pory Roku
Dzisiaj jest pt gru 27, 2024 11:29 pm

Strefa czasowa UTC+2godz.




Nowy temat Odpowiedz w temacie  [ Posty: 64 ]  Przejdź na stronę Poprzednia  1, 2, 3, 4  Następna
Autor Wiadomość
 Tytuł:
PostZamieszczono: pt sty 14, 2005 7:48 am 
Offline

Rejestracja: czw maja 20, 2004 10:58 am
Posty: 2199
Lokalizacja: C2 - 9
Mieszkaniec osiedla: Tak
wielkie dzięki - nie spodziewałem się tak dokładnego opisu. Pewne pojęcie na temat programowania mam ale w Pascalu. Więc się trochę orientowałem a teraz myślę że sobie poradzę również w tu.


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: śr sty 26, 2005 2:21 pm 
Offline

Rejestracja: czw maja 20, 2004 10:58 am
Posty: 2199
Lokalizacja: C2 - 9
Mieszkaniec osiedla: Tak
Mam kolejne pytanie - Jest funkcja Liczba.całk() która zwraca część całkowitąl liczby. a czy jest funkcja która zwraca część dziesiętną.

A może jest funkcja która przelicza wartość 5.32 czyli pięć minut i 32 sekundy na liczbę sekund


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: śr sty 26, 2005 2:48 pm 
Offline
Awatar użytkownika

Rejestracja: pn mar 29, 2004 1:38 pm
Posty: 1813
Lokalizacja: Vivaldiego 2 !!!
mozna to rozwiazac tak x=y-liczba.całk(y)

x -część ułamkowa liczby
y - liczba

_________________
------------------------------------
Nie traktuj życia zbyt serio. I tak nie wyjdziesz z niego żywy
Cała Polska w Cieniu Śląska !!!

Obrazek


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: śr sty 26, 2005 5:42 pm 
Offline

Rejestracja: czw maja 20, 2004 10:58 am
Posty: 2199
Lokalizacja: C2 - 9
Mieszkaniec osiedla: Tak
tak wynik jest ok, ale mi nie chodzi o pozostawienie części dzięsiętnej w wartości ułamkowej tylko też jako całkowitą.

np.5,15
czesc całkowita =5
czesc dziesiętna = 15
po zastosowaniu tamtego wzoru otrzymuje się 0,15 - a nie o to mi chodzi.

Pozdrawiam


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: śr sty 26, 2005 5:55 pm 
Offline
Awatar użytkownika

Rejestracja: pn mar 29, 2004 1:38 pm
Posty: 1813
Lokalizacja: Vivaldiego 2 !!!
To pomnóż przez 100 i po zawodach :-)

_________________
------------------------------------
Nie traktuj życia zbyt serio. I tak nie wyjdziesz z niego żywy
Cała Polska w Cieniu Śląska !!!

Obrazek


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: śr sty 26, 2005 9:32 pm 
Offline

Rejestracja: czw maja 20, 2004 10:58 am
Posty: 2199
Lokalizacja: C2 - 9
Mieszkaniec osiedla: Tak
pomysłałem że taka może być odpowiedź ale jak jużbyłem w samochodzi z pracy. tyle że jak cyfra jest 0,156765 a następna 0,23235655656644654444444...44444 to się komplikuje. A ma działać zawsze i z automatu


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: śr sty 26, 2005 10:18 pm 
Offline
Awatar użytkownika

Rejestracja: pn mar 29, 2004 1:38 pm
Posty: 1813
Lokalizacja: Vivaldiego 2 !!!
To ja zapytam tak. Jakią liczbę spodziewałbyś się otrzymać, gdyby jej rozwinięcie dziesiętne było nieskończone. Np 1/3 w notacji dziesiętnej. Co miło by być wynikiem ? 33, 333 , czy jeszcze coś innego ? Myslałem , że po przecinku pojawią sie góra 2 cyfry.

_________________
------------------------------------
Nie traktuj życia zbyt serio. I tak nie wyjdziesz z niego żywy
Cała Polska w Cieniu Śląska !!!

Obrazek


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: śr sty 26, 2005 10:21 pm 
Offline

Rejestracja: czw maja 20, 2004 10:58 am
Posty: 2199
Lokalizacja: C2 - 9
Mieszkaniec osiedla: Tak
no jasne że przesadzam z liczbami z x miejscami po przecinku - ale nie jest to stała cyfra.


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: śr sty 26, 2005 10:30 pm 
Offline
Awatar użytkownika

Rejestracja: pn mar 29, 2004 1:38 pm
Posty: 1813
Lokalizacja: Vivaldiego 2 !!!
OK to jutro , po przyjsciu do pracy spróbuje to rozwiązać. W domu niestety nie mam zainstalowanego Offica :-( Chyba , że ktos mnie uprzedzi. Np Pieszy.

_________________
------------------------------------
Nie traktuj życia zbyt serio. I tak nie wyjdziesz z niego żywy
Cała Polska w Cieniu Śląska !!!

Obrazek


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: śr sty 26, 2005 11:57 pm 
Offline
CPR Vertical Team
Awatar użytkownika

Rejestracja: wt mar 30, 2004 4:57 pm
Posty: 5139
Lokalizacja: A8 - 30
Mieszkaniec osiedla: Tak
Jeśli dobrze rozumiem masz Lesławie kwiatki takie:
12,345
45,34444
13,1
5,8

?
I chcesz żeby je rozdzieliło w miejscu przecinka ? Bo jeśli tak to jeśli są jedna pod drugą w kolumnie to możesz zaznaczyc kolumnę i potraktowac je z menu Dane->Tekst jako kolumny.
I potem typ pliku - Rozdzielany, następnie wskazujesz typ separatora, w przykladzie jest to przecinek, hops, i liczby dzielą się na dwie kolumny z których w pierwszej masz czesc calkowitą, z drugiej to co po przecinku, tez jako liczba calkowita.


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: czw sty 27, 2005 3:44 am 
Offline
Awatar użytkownika

Rejestracja: wt kwie 06, 2004 8:54 am
Posty: 793
Lokalizacja: N51 20' 11.8" _________E16 38' 1.0"
Mieszkaniec osiedla: Tak
Proponuję zrobić to tak jak zaproponował rav:

rav pisze:
mozna to rozwiazac tak x=y-liczba.całk(y)

x -część ułamkowa liczby
y - liczba


i

rav pisze:
To pomnóż przez 100 i po zawodach :-)


W celu ograniczenia liczby cyfr do np 2, powinieneś najpierw zaokrąglić pierwotną liczbę do 2 miejsca po przecinku. Zapis tej funkcji będzie wtedy wyglądał następująco:

=ILOCZYN(SUMA(ZAOKR(A1;2);-LICZBA.CAŁK(A1));100)

gdzie A1 to adres liczby pierwotnej (wejściowej).

Jedynym problemem będzie to, że wynik będzie wartością zaokrągloną tego, co jest po przecinku. Np. jeżeli liczbą pierwotną będzie
7,58954
to wynikiem formuły będzie
59

Jeżeli chcesz otrzymać np. 2 pierwsze liczby po przecinku , ale bez zaokrąglania, to zapis powinien wyglądać tak:

=LICZBA.CAŁK(ILOCZYN(SUMA(A3;-LICZBA.CAŁK(A3));100);0)

Taka funkcja najpierw wykonuje to, co opisał rav, czyli odzyskuje to co jest po przecinku i mnoży to przez 100 a następnie odzyskuje z tego część całkowitą. Wynikiem tej funkcji będzie liczba
58

_________________
Obrazek
no tears to cry, no feelings left
the species has amused itself to death


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: czw sty 27, 2005 9:01 am 
Offline

Rejestracja: czw maja 20, 2004 10:58 am
Posty: 2199
Lokalizacja: C2 - 9
Mieszkaniec osiedla: Tak
dzięki za rady - ciekawym pomysłem jest pomysł Tomasza, zabieram się do realizacji funkcji


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: czw sty 27, 2005 9:28 am 
Offline
Awatar użytkownika

Rejestracja: pn mar 29, 2004 1:38 pm
Posty: 1813
Lokalizacja: Vivaldiego 2 !!!
Mam jeszcze inne rozwiązanie (bez grzebania w menu). Ono działa tak że gdy liczba ma 3 miejsca po przecinku to wynikiem jest liczba 3 cyfrowa , jeśli 5 miejsc to 5-cio cyfrowa, jeśli 10 to 10-cio cyfrowa itd. A teraz rozwiązanie:

=(A1-LICZBA.CAŁK(A1))*(10^(DŁ(A1-LICZBA.CAŁK(A1))-2))

pierwszy człon wyciąga część ułamkową z liczby a drugi mnozy ją razy 10 do tej potęgi ile liczba ma miejsc po przecinku.

_________________
------------------------------------
Nie traktuj życia zbyt serio. I tak nie wyjdziesz z niego żywy
Cała Polska w Cieniu Śląska !!!

Obrazek


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: czw sty 27, 2005 9:35 am 
Offline

Rejestracja: czw maja 20, 2004 10:58 am
Posty: 2199
Lokalizacja: C2 - 9
Mieszkaniec osiedla: Tak
powaliłaś mnie z nóg :ave: - dziwnym pozostaje dla mnie fakt że nie ma przeciwnej funkcji do liczba.całk() - dzięki jeszcze raz


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: czw sty 27, 2005 12:41 pm 
Offline
Awatar użytkownika

Rejestracja: wt kwie 06, 2004 8:54 am
Posty: 793
Lokalizacja: N51 20' 11.8" _________E16 38' 1.0"
Mieszkaniec osiedla: Tak
Mnie to nie dziwi tak samo jak to, że nie ma funkcji dzielenia. Jest tylko iloczyn, czyli mnożenie. Jak ktoś chce dzielić to musi mnożyć przez odwrotność. Gdyby Bill Gates i spółka chcieli opisać funkcjami wszystko, co może się komukolwiek, kiedykolwiek przydać, to pewnie brakło by jednej płyty instalacyjnej na Excela. To, że mogłeś wybierać z conajmniej 2 propozycji rozwiązań jest najlepszym dowodem na to, że nie potrzeba funkcji odwrotnej do funkcji LICZBA.CAŁK().

_________________
Obrazek
no tears to cry, no feelings left
the species has amused itself to death


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: czw sty 27, 2005 12:49 pm 
Offline
Awatar użytkownika

Rejestracja: pn mar 29, 2004 1:38 pm
Posty: 1813
Lokalizacja: Vivaldiego 2 !!!
Lesław Dobrzyński pisze:
powalił mnie z nóg :ave: - dziwnym pozostaje dla mnie fakt że nie ma przeciwnej funkcji do liczba.całk() - dzięki jeszcze raz


Nie ma za co :-)

Ps. Proszę o nie kojarzenie mojego avataru z płcią. Bardziej adekwatna była by końcówka eś. Chyba , ze to literówka :-)

_________________
------------------------------------
Nie traktuj życia zbyt serio. I tak nie wyjdziesz z niego żywy
Cała Polska w Cieniu Śląska !!!

Obrazek


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: czw sty 27, 2005 1:11 pm 
Offline
Awatar użytkownika

Rejestracja: wt cze 08, 2004 3:56 pm
Posty: 2539
Lokalizacja: Wrocław
Mieszkaniec osiedla: Nie
rav pisze:
Lesław Dobrzyński pisze:
powalił mnie z nóg :ave: - dziwnym pozostaje dla mnie fakt że nie ma przeciwnej funkcji do liczba.całk() - dzięki jeszcze raz


Nie ma za co :-)

Ps. Proszę o nie kojarzenie mojego avataru z płcią. Bardziej adekwatna była by końcówka eś. Chyba , ze to literówka :-)


Nie przejmuj się to już druga wpadka autora. :D

_________________
Mam czteropak Calsberga i nie zawaham się go użyć :D


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: czw sty 27, 2005 2:18 pm 
Offline

Rejestracja: pt maja 07, 2004 9:35 pm
Posty: 448
Lokalizacja: C2 - 9
czy porady odnośnie STATISTICA tez udzielacie??


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: czw sty 27, 2005 3:11 pm 
Offline

Rejestracja: czw maja 20, 2004 10:58 am
Posty: 2199
Lokalizacja: C2 - 9
Mieszkaniec osiedla: Tak
małe kwiatki - formuła RAV ogólnie jest ok ale poniżej wkleje małe niespodzianki
3,03 - 299999999999998

1,09 - 900000000000001
6,01 - 999999999999979
2,09 - 899999999999999

5,10 - 999999999999996
9,54 - 539999999999999
większość oprócz tych dwóch ostatnich przykładów to liczby z pierwszą liczbą po przecinku zero . i co wy na no. :cry:


Na górę
 Wyświetl profil  
 
 Tytuł:
PostZamieszczono: czw sty 27, 2005 4:14 pm 
Offline
Awatar użytkownika

Rejestracja: pn mar 29, 2004 1:38 pm
Posty: 1813
Lokalizacja: Vivaldiego 2 !!!
Faktycznie pojawiają się takie kosmosy. Sam nie wiem czemu i gdzie jest wina :-(. Spróbuje coś pokombinować.

1,01 jest OK ale
2,01 już nie.

Przecież to parodia :-(

_________________
------------------------------------
Nie traktuj życia zbyt serio. I tak nie wyjdziesz z niego żywy
Cała Polska w Cieniu Śląska !!!

Obrazek


Na górę
 Wyświetl profil  
 
Wyświetl posty nie starsze niż:  Sortuj wg  
Nowy temat Odpowiedz w temacie  [ Posty: 64 ]  Przejdź na stronę Poprzednia  1, 2, 3, 4  Następna

Strefa czasowa UTC+2godz.


Kto jest online

Użytkownicy przeglądający to forum: Nie ma żadnego zarejestrowanego użytkownika i 44 gości


Nie możesz tworzyć nowych tematów
Nie możesz odpowiadać w tematach
Nie możesz zmieniać swoich postów
Nie możesz usuwać swoich postów
Nie możesz dodawać załączników

Szukaj:
Przejdź do:  
cron
Powered by phpBB® Forum Software © phpBB Group